The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na is a historic Cistercian monastery nestled in the picturesque Valldigna Valley, within the municipality of Simat de la Valldigna, Valencia, Spain. Founded in 1298 by King James II of Aragon, this significant religious building stands at an elevation of approximately 51 meters, at the foot of the Mola del Toro. It represents a remarkable blend of architectural styles, primarily Gothic and Baroque, reflecting centuries of history and renovation.

    Wonderful Cistercian-style monastery founded in 1298 by Jaume II el Just, one of the historical jewels that remain from the ancient Kingdom of Valencia.
    Since April 2022 it has been open to the public and deserves to be visited. Inside the enclosure there are ruins of the various buildings that were part of the old monastery and that today are partly under recovery work.
    It is a very quiet and beautiful place a few meters from the town of Simat that also deserves to be included in the tour and has many hiking trails.

    What kind of architectural styles can I expect to see at the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na?

    The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na showcases a fascinating blend of architectural styles due to centuries of construction, destruction, and renovation. You will primarily see elements of Gothic and Baroque architecture, with some Renaissance and Neoclassical details also present. The Church of Santa María, for instance, beautifully combines Gothic and Baroque features, while the Portal Nou is a striking example of 14th-century Gothic design.

    What is the historical significance of the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na?

    The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na holds immense historical significance as one of the most important Cistercian monasteries in the Kingdom of Valencia. Founded in 1298 by King James II, it played a crucial role in the economic, political, and cultural life of the region for nearly six centuries. Its history reflects the evolution of Valencian society, from its foundation legend to its abandonment during the Ecclesiastical Confiscations and subsequent restoration efforts, making it a symbol of Valencian heritage.

    Are there any specific parts of the monastery that are particularly well-preserved or notable?

    Despite its turbulent history, several parts of the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na are notably well-preserved or have been meticulously restored. The Church of Santa María is considered the best-preserved building, showcasing intricate Gothic and Baroque elements. The Cloister, a central feature of Cistercian architecture, and the Chapter House, designed by Pere Compte, are also significant. Additionally, the Portal Nou, the main Gothic entrance, is a striking feature.

    Is there an entrance fee to visit the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na?

    No, entry to the Monasterio de Santa María de la Valldigna is free. This makes it an accessible and enriching destination for all visitors interested in history, architecture, and Valencian heritage. Free guided tours are also available on Saturday and Sunday mornings, offering an even deeper insight into the monastery's past.
